From 33058f2b292b3a581333bdfb21b8f671898c5060 Mon Sep 17 00:00:00 2001 From: Peter Bengtsson Date: Tue, 8 Dec 2020 14:40:17 -0500 Subject: initial commit --- .../api/htmlmediaelement/videotracks/index.html | 63 ++++++++++++++++++++++ 1 file changed, 63 insertions(+) create mode 100644 files/ja/web/api/htmlmediaelement/videotracks/index.html (limited to 'files/ja/web/api/htmlmediaelement/videotracks') diff --git a/files/ja/web/api/htmlmediaelement/videotracks/index.html b/files/ja/web/api/htmlmediaelement/videotracks/index.html new file mode 100644 index 0000000000..284d84db3d --- /dev/null +++ b/files/ja/web/api/htmlmediaelement/videotracks/index.html @@ -0,0 +1,63 @@ +--- +title: HTMLMediaElement.videoTracks +slug: Web/API/HTMLMediaElement/videoTracks +tags: + - API + - HTML DOM + - HTMLMediaElement + - Media + - Property + - Reference + - Tracks + - Video + - Video Tracks + - Web + - videoTracks +translation_of: Web/API/HTMLMediaElement/videoTracks +--- +
{{APIRef("HTML DOM")}}{{draft}}
+ +

{{DOMxRef("HTMLMediaElement")}} オブジェクトの読み取り専用の videoTracks プロパティは、メディア要素の動画トラックを表すすべての {{DOMxRef("VideoTrack")}} オブジェクトを列挙した {{DOMxRef("VideoTrackList")}} オブジェクトを返します。

+ +

返されたリストはライブです。 つまり、トラックがメディア要素に追加されたり取り除かれたりすると、リストの内容は動的に変化します。 リストへの参照を取得したら、新しい動画トラックが追加されたのか既存のトラックが取り除かれたのかを検出するために変更を監視できます。 メディア要素のトラックリストへの変更を監視する方法の詳細については、{{DOMxRef("VideoTrackList")}} のイベントハンドラを参照してください。

+ +

構文

+ +
var videoTracks = mediaElement.videoTracks;
+ +

+ +

メディア要素に含まれる動画トラックのリストを表す {{DOMxRef("VideoTrackList")}} オブジェクト。 トラックのリストは、配列記法や、オブジェクトの {{domxref("VideoTrackList.getTrackById", "getTrackById()")}} メソッドを使ってアクセスできます。

+ +

各トラックは、トラックに関する情報を提供する {{DOMxRef("VideoTrack")}} オブジェクトによって表されます。

+ +

仕様

+ + + + + + + + + + + + + + +
仕様状態コメント
{{SpecName("HTML WHATWG", "#dom-media-videotracks", "HTMLMediaElement.videoTracks")}}{{Spec2("HTML WHATWG")}}{{SpecName('HTML5 W3C')}} から変更なし
+ +

ブラウザーの対応

+ + + +

{{Compat("api.HTMLMediaElement.videoTracks")}}

+ +

関連情報

+ + -- cgit v1.2.3-54-g00ecf